Credit unions are not-for-profit, member-owned organizations that operate on a democratic one-person-one-vote basis. Credit unions are governed by boards of directors that are electe by and from the membership themselves, making them different from banks and other non-profit financial institutions. Online & Mobile Banking

Online and mobile banking allow members to manage their accounts on the go. These services give customers access to a variety of functions, such as depositing checks, viewing transaction history, paying bills, paying loans and finding ATMs.

Online banking is performed through a web-based platform that requires no special software. It is accessible through any browser on a desktop, laptop or mobile device.

Basic SMS Transactions

Mobile banking, on the other hand, uses an app that is downloaded to a smartphone. It provides basic SMS transactions, such as balance check, transfer, and transaction status updates.

Cybersecurity is also an important concern for mobile banks, which protect personal information from theft or damage. Banks often use encryption, secondary authentication and facial recognition to keep account information secure.

Automatic Notifications

Some online banking portals also offer automatic notifications that let you know if there are changes to your account. This can help you stay informed and save you time, as it can alert you to direct deposits, large payments, overdrafts or other events in your account.
